On July 5, 2025, the Vermont Center for Emerging Technologies (VCET) in Burlington launched a new online job portal that specifically beats the bridge between job seekers and companies. The platform is intended to make connections and attract talented people in the region and thus fuel the local technology scene. This reports WCAX.
The times are cheap! According to VCET, the market for job seekers and employers in Vermont is promising. Nevertheless, many job seekers, especially the younger ones, fight in the flood of online offers that are often not from here or even contain fake postings. The new job portal should help here: With a curated list of tech-savvy startups and also well-known companies such as dealer.com and the University of Vermont, the portal makes it easier to get started with the career landscape. Another interesting offer comes from the Vermont Technology Alliance (VTTA), which provides a variety of job options in technology and non-tech sectors. There are between 150 and 250 jobs solely listed by member companies. The job offers are updated regularly and are free of charge for members, which increases visibility. In this way, job seekers can easily search for locally suitable jobs, regardless of whether they have an apprenticeship, special qualifications or extensive experience. A look at the available places shows that everything is offered from technical positions such as Senior Full Stack software engineer to administrative roles.
